증서
Korean
Etymology 1
Sino-Korean word from 證書.
Pronunciation
- (SK Standard/Seoul) IPA(key): [t͡ɕɯŋsʰʌ̹]
- Phonetic hangul: [증서]
Romanizations | |
---|---|
Revised Romanization? | jeungseo |
Revised Romanization (translit.)? | jeungseo |
McCune–Reischauer? | chŭngsŏ |
Yale Romanization? | cungse |
Noun
증서 • (jeungseo) (hanja 證書)
- certificate
